Warminster Town Council is asking for help from two Warminster headteachers to solve highways issues in the town. Councillor Sue Fraser and Councillor Paul Macdonald have been asked by the Town Development Committee to approach Minster School headteacher Lisa Tudor to discuss what action can be taken in regard to traffic, pollution and parking in Emwell Street. A resident has complained to the council about issues on the one-way street at the start and end of the school day.
Meanwhile, councillors have encouraged Highway Youth Football Club to discuss using Kingdown School’s car park for members of the club to park in during training and match sessions. This is in a bid to alleviate congestion and parking on the road outside the club’s home in Woodcock Road.
